Transaction 5edbf8ecc67c0fb8aed4c9f58c366c73945a1fce6ec73e415031d953744a2f02

26 Input
1 Outputs
  • 5edbf8ecc67c0fb8aed4c9f58c366c73945a1fce6ec73e415031d953744a2f02:0
  • value  49820580
    address  1FAv42GaDuQixSzEzSbx6aP1Kf4WVWpQUY